Stephen Hawking's Quest to Answer the Big Questions of Existence
What if you could uncover the answers to humanity's biggest questions: Where did we come from? Is there a God? Are we alone? Will we survive, and what lies beyond Earth? In Brief Answers to the Big Questions, Stephen Hawking takes readers on a journey through science, philosophy, and his own life's story to explore these profound mysteries. He argues that the tools of physics—reason, mathematics, and empirical observation—can help answer questions once reserved for religion or mysticism. His goal is to show how understanding the universe is not only possible but essential for humanity's survival and sense of meaning.
Hawking contends that the universe can be explained through scientific laws rather than divine intervention. He sees beauty and design not as the work of a supernatural being, but as the result of immutable physical principles that humans are capable of understanding. At the same time, he warns that our future depends on how wisely we use this knowledge. Technology, artificial intelligence, and exploration—tools of human progress—can either elevate humanity or destroy it. The book blends these existential debates with Hawking’s reflections on his remarkable life, showing how personal struggle and curiosity drove his quest for cosmic truth.
Science Versus the Limits of Religion
Throughout history, humans turned to religion to explain natural phenomena—the origin of the stars, the cause of lightning, or the mystery of life. Hawking acknowledges that faith provided comfort but suggests that science gives us more reliable insight. He doesn’t dismiss belief outright; instead, he reframes God as a metaphor for the laws of nature. For Hawking, asking whether there is a God is less about theology and more about understanding causality—is there something beyond scientific explanation, or can the universe explain itself? By examining the Big Bang, cosmology, and quantum physics, he concludes that the universe can arise spontaneously from nothing—a concept that challenges traditional creation myths but celebrates the power of scientific imagination.
From the Big Bang to Black Holes
The book revisits Hawking’s groundbreaking discoveries on black holes, singularities, and Hawking radiation—concepts that revolutionized theoretical physics. Kip Thorne’s introduction illustrates how Hawking moved from questioning the beginning of time to proving that black holes radiate energy, thereby connecting general relativity, quantum mechanics, and thermodynamics. These insights reveal that the cosmos operates by elegant, discoverable laws, even in its most extreme places. Hawking’s lifelong pursuit of a “theory of everything” reflects his belief that science can unite apparent contradictions—gravity and quantum mechanics, freedom and determinism, creation and nothingness.
Humanity’s Place in a Vast Universe
Beyond physics, Hawking looks outward to humanity’s destiny among the stars. He warns that Earth is fragile—threatened by climate change, nuclear proliferation, and reckless technology—and that we must evolve beyond our planetary cradle. Colonizing space, he suggests, is not escapism but realism; it’s how we might ensure survival. He compares this to historical milestones—from Columbus’s voyages to the Moon landing—and argues that curiosity and courage have always driven human progress. But exploration must be paired with wisdom. Artificial intelligence and genetic engineering can redefine humanity, but without ethical restraint they could render us obsolete.
